If you’re gluten-free and in Okinawa this spot is a MUST. I was searching for GF options and couldn't believe the entire menu here is gluten-free. As someone with both gluten and dairy allergies, dining out in Japan can be a challenge but this restaurant went above and beyond.
Definitely make a reservation in advance. We tried to walk in on our first night, but they were fully booked. Thankfully, the staff was very kind and helped us secure a reservation for the following evening. It’s a prix fixe menu, and when I mentioned my dairy allergy, the owner was incredibly accommodating and customized the entire experience for me. That kind of care is rare in Japan and truly appreciated.
The food was exceptional, Italian dishes made with care, with an excellent wine selection and I highly recommend the wine pairing. The flavors, presentation, and attention to detail made it one of the best meals I’ve had anywhere. Bonus: they sell their gluten-free bread to take home which was such a treat to have for the rest of my trip.
The atmosphere is cozy and intimate, run by a hardworking local couple who made us feel so welcome. You can tell they genuinely love what they do. This place is a standout for anyone but especially a dream for gluten-free travelers in Japan.
